Transaction 35f14ba2eff88ccca2881bee9443493ee9a78fabce1ddc918786dad73c3b5dd3

block
587512a711c8113b129769a67bee2dbbe7565a5f360995b8ea47e71f31254971

1 Input

24 Outputs